Generally I prefer to open toys, however, as someone who has opened this particular figure before, it's quite the hassle. Due to the awkward proportions of the box as it angles inwards towards the bottom, it's nearly impossible to remove the figure without destroying the packaging because of the cardboard background inside. In addition it has the late 2000s twisty ties that are annoying to cut. As such, I'd leave it in the packaging as the box is very nice looking.

In my opinion, Dark Empire is a mixed bag as it has a bunch of really cool ideas and stands well on its own but when put together with the rest of the EU, it creates numerous problems and doesn't meld all that well to the point where it isn't referenced all that much in Legends. It also does many of the things that the Rise of Skywalker did such as bring Palpatine back, introduce a planet destroying Star Destroyer and a massive Empire which seemingly came out of nowhere with huge fleets. It also suffers from the Sequel Trilogy's problem of too many superweapons with the Planet Devastators which strip entire planets of their resources and can build massive fleets and armies. So many of the problems that the Sequel Trilogy had unfortunately also apply to Dark Empire but I do recommend it to give it a shot as the art is good although the colouring can make things hard to see and the story itself is pretty good.

Most of 76's content can be enjoyed solo aside from group events, also you'll usually not see other players very often while running around the map. In addition the map marks every players' location on the map unless they're under stealth. As for PVP, it's practically non-existent due to the pacifist mode toggle in the settings which prevents players from damaging you and vice-versa. Plus there is no in-game chat, the only way to easily communicate with other players is through emotes or your microphone. Most of the game feels like a single-player game with multiplayer slapped onto it. I'd say to give it a shot although I recommend consulting the Fo76 subreddit for tips on the gameplay.
